Transaction 56108c151c07b69c28d26516abf6a79e7a80f94273f092ff459e673660c4eea7
1 Input
2 Outputs
- 56108c151c07b69c28d26516abf6a79e7a80f94273f092ff459e673660c4eea7:0
- 56108c151c07b69c28d26516abf6a79e7a80f94273f092ff459e673660c4eea7:1
value 113557
address 15hhMMzdxLxZ73FTMe555N5oc2Y7VGbgEF
value 61521284
address 3PsvSDg3ZVjzxtVKTZNASKQMGaBmhVwoEi